When a user's Windows Update service is missing, deleted, or severely corrupted—often preventing updates or causing error messages—this paste provides a rapid way to restore the necessary registry keys. Key Contents of 8tWfDyMe
It's crucial to understand that the content of any Pastebin is user-generated and not officially vetted. The script you see is a direct dump of registry keys, which, if maliciously altered, could cause system instability. The version linked here has been referenced by several independent tech support sites like and Mundowin , which often points to its legitimacy within the support community.

Pastebin.com entry 8twfdyme serves as a technical resource for restoring the Windows Update service by providing registry configuration data to repair corrupted wuauserv entries. Users typically convert this raw data into a .reg file to re-register the service, often paired with command-line tools to fix system errors.
